Did you know one council collects your bins, but another disposes of the waste? Or that different councils handle roads and parks? And if you run a food business in Lincolnshire you would contact the county council to apply for a pavement café licence but a different council would do your food hygiene inspections.
County, borough, city, and district councils share these different responsibilities.
The government plans to replace this system with new unitary councils - a single 'tier'. This single organisation will deliver all local services and will be one point of contact, simplifying who does what and how.
